Abstract
A Monte Carlo program has been written to model the in vivo X-ray fluorescence of lead in the kidney, to aid the choice of one of four candidate fluorescing source/measurement geometry combinations: 109Cd/180', 57Co/90' and 99Tcm at both 180' and 90'. Computational studies and practical considerations led to the choice of 99Tcm in a backscatter geometry for the measurement system.
